Descrizione
Shaped vase with a relief salamander, invention by Giovanni Gariboldi [inv. 3524]. Richard-Ginori Ceramics Company, 1937. In this case, the reference to non-Western culture is twofold: on one hand, Gariboldi uses a form clearly inspired by typical East Asian shapes (see, for example, certain bottles produced during the Ming dynasty, Wanli period); on the other hand, the celadon glaze used for the coating is a material commonly found in Chinese ceramics. The vase was created for the 1937 International Exhibition Arts et Techniques dans la Vie moderne in Paris.
